GABA will be the most generally distributed inhibitory transmitter within a mammalian CNS. It contributes to about forty% of our Mind synapses and are available inside the interneurons from the spinal wire, neocortex and cerebellum [85]. It is made by GABAergic neurons, that are concentrated while in the brain. Within the anxious procedure, GABA can bind into the ionotropic GABAA-receptors or metabotropic GABAB-receptors, considering that They are really greatly found in the nervous procedure with GABAB and concentrated at the presynaptic nerve terminals and during the CNS.

Investigate on conolidine is proscribed, nevertheless the few scientific studies available exhibit Proleviate Blocks Pain Receptors the drug retains guarantee for a attainable opiate-like therapeutic for Long-term pain. Conolidine was first synthesized in 2011 as A part of a research by Tarselli et al. (60) The primary de novo pathway to synthetic creation observed that their synthesized sort served as effective analgesics against chronic, persistent pain in an in-vivo product (60). A biphasic pain model was used, by which formalin Remedy is injected into a rodent’s paw. This brings about a Principal pain reaction right away pursuing injection and a secondary pain reaction twenty - forty minutes after injection (sixty two).
